INTERVIEW: Monogold

The Softest Glow - Album Art

A Little Background
 
Monogold is a three piece hailing from Brooklyn, NY. Their DIY approach to music has enabled them to self record and produce their own sound in their personal studio. Their most recent release and first full-length album is 2011’s The Softest Glow. Their 2009 EP, We Animals, continues to receive rave reviews from blogs and magazines throughout the U.S. and abroad.
 
Last year The Wall Street Journal chose Monogold as a band to see at CMJ, saying, “…bassist Mike Falotico and drummer Jared Apuzzo build rhythmic foundations for guitarist-vocalist Keith Kelly to inhabit with his reverberative falsetto and ringing, euphonic chords. Monogold crafts six-string dreamscapes.”
 
Their latest album, The Softest Glow has been on constant play around the office it’s an easy and at most points upbeat, sometimes haunting listen from start to finish. Favorite tracks include “Spirit or Something” and “Feel Animal”. As an interesting side note the album art seen above was originally a four foot painting that band member, Keith painted and then photographed to use as the album cover. I would totally hang that anywhere in my domain. Hey Keith, save some talent for the rest of us!

1.  How would you describe your sound and what are your influences?
 
Our sound seems to come from some eclectic influences. Anything from the 50s 60s surf sound ( The Shadows) to the sparse, rhythmic influence of the Talking Heads.
 
2. What are some songs or artists you are really in to right now?

On the last tour we were on there was a lot of the new Sharon Van Etten, Beach House, Liars, Ruby Suns being listened to.

3. When you’re not playing music what do you like to do?

When not playing music I (Keith) paint a lot, Jared has his own recording studio, and of course we all dabble in the service industry bartending etc, strictly for the love of it of course.
